Firefox 17.0b5 (2012-11-07) Device: Galaxy S2 OS: Android 4.0.3 Steps to reproduce: 1. Go to espn.go.com Expected result: ESPN touch version is loaded. Actual result: A basic HTML mobile site is loaded (see attached screenshot). Notes: On stock browser, the correct site version is loaded. The page looks different on the Nightly and Aurora than it looks on the stock browser and it looks on the Beta build.

Interesting. I see the touch site using Firefox 16. Using Nightly 19 I see the desktop site. Seems to be a regression. Perhaps they don't recognize the updated version in the UA. As the screenshots show, ESPN is also not serving their videos to Firefox. (Main picture is a click target in the stock browser but not in Firefox.)
